Abstract

Clinical results of a new contraceptive pills--Marvelon (Organon) were studied. 32 women, ages 30 +/- 5 years, participated in the study during at least 6 cycles. Marvelon was good tolerated and subjective side-effects were very low. The cycles were regular, duration of withdrawal bleeding was 3-5 days and the amount of the blood lost were unchanged or milder. Marvelon didn't affect body weight and blood pressure. Favourable lipid profile--increased a mean level of HDL-Cholesterol and decreased a mean level of LDL-Cholesterol were noticed. Pearl Index was 0,0.
